#a68d7c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a68d7c is composed of 65.1% red, 55.3%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.1% magenta, 25.3%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 24.3 degrees, a saturation of 19.1% and a lightness of 56.9%. #a68d7c color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ff8 with #4d1b00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#a68d7c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a68d7c has RGB values of R:166, G:141,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0.25,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10915196.
